Pemberton to face court martial proceedings in US

Convicted killer US Marine Lance Cpl. Joseph Scott Pemberton will face court martial proceedings in the United States despite the pardon granted to him by President Rodrigo R. Duterte.

Former legal counsel to the Laude camp and Presidential Spokesperson Harry Roque confirmed that the proceeding has been assured by the US authorities. This will determine if Pemberton will face additional sanctions in his home country and if he will be allowed to return to service after being convicted of the killing of Filipino transgender woman Jennifer Laude.

Meanwhile, Roque responded to the allegation of Julita Laude that President Duterte failed to fulfill his promise to keep Pemberton locked up in jail while he is the country’s President.

“Ang alam ko po, walang ganiyang promise ang Presidente. Ang pangako po ni Presidente ay bibigyan ng katarungan ang pagkamatay ni Jennifer Laude, at nakulong naman po si Pemberton nang halos anim na taon (What I know is the President did not promise anything like that. His promise is to give justice for the death of Jennifer Laude, and Pemberton was imprisoned for almost 6 years),” Roque explained.

“I can confirm the President gave them financial aid, three times. Pero iyong halaga bahala na po ang—huwag na nating isapubliko dahil ayaw ngang ilabas sana ni Presidente iyong tulong niya sa Laude family (As for the worth, I cannot disclose the amount since the President does not want to let it be known that he helped the Laude family),” Roque added. – Report from Mela Lesmoras
